Outfitting Breezer Doppler
I just got a new 2018 Breezer Doppler Cafe this week. I was told by my LBS that a kickstand cannot be fitted due to the hydraulic line and derailleur cable running under the bottom bracket and due to the disc brake rotors on the rear triangle. I am really wanting the Pletcher dual leg kickstand. Anybody ever install one on a Doppler?
Also need front and rear rack ideas for getting groceries and hauling things from stores. No touring is in my plans for now. Axles are 12mm through axles if that matters.
Need a good solid rear view mirror too.

You'd have to flip the bike over and give us a picture of the area behind the bottom bracket for us to judge the ability to mount a kickstand- you can often move the tubing out of the way of the kickstand clamp, im.surprised tjats the reason it can't be mounted. But it's not uncommon for there to be a reason a kickstand won't fit. And yeah, a rear triangle kickstand won't work there.
I'm not well versed on racks for thru axle bikes, but there are racks that mount through your rear thru axle, maybe a front thru axle too. Your rear has typical rack mounts, but the eyelets above the rear rack are kinda high (they're probably just intended for the mudguards. The eyelets halfway up the fork are great points for mounting front racks, but it will also need to connect at the front thru axle, or at the bolt/hole that I assume exists right above the front tire, where the fork meets.
